Evaluation of Effect of Bank Credits on Production and Export of Agricultural Sector (1984-2006)

Abstract

The main purpose of this study was to examin the circumstance of bank credits effect on production and export of agricultural sector over the 1984-2006 periods. First, by using time series analysis, stationary and cointegration between variables were analysed and long-run relationship was estimated. To this end, the Johansen's cointegration method and several other methods (such as SUR) for production and export have been used.
The results show that variables of credits, investment stock and labor had positive and significant impacts on value added of agricultural sector. The results also revealed that variables of value added, real exchange rate and capital stock had positive and significant impacts on agricultural export sector.Research finding reveal that there is a positive relation between bank credits and agricultural export in this section.
